How These Movies Create Tension and Engagement

At their core, Law and Order Movies That Will Keep You on the Edge rely on structure, character, and moral uncertainty to build sustained tension. Unlike fast-paced action films, these stories often unfold at a deliberate pace, allowing details to emerge gradually. Viewers are invited to piece together clues, question motivations, and reconsider assumptions just as the characters do. For example, a film might center on a seemingly straightforward case that slowly reveals layers of corruption, personal bias, or institutional failure. The tension comes not from sudden violence, but from the creeping realization that the truth is malleable and justice is rarely black and white. This methodical pacing encourages active viewing, making the audience complicit in the investigation.

Common Questions People Have

What makes a crime film feel suspenseful without relying on violence?

Suspense in these films often comes from legal ambiguity, procedural delays, and the constant threat of unseen consequences. Directors use tight pacing, atmospheric lighting, and restrained performances to maintain unease. The audience is kept uncertain about outcomes, even when the general direction of the story is clear.

Are these movies based on real cases?

Many draw inspiration from high-profile legal events or systemic patterns, but they typically fictionalize details to protect privacy and enhance narrative impact. This blending of realism and dramatization is part of what makes Law and Order Movies That Will Keep You on the Edge so compellingโ€”they feel uncomfortably plausible.

Can watching these films actually improve critical thinking?

Yes, in subtle ways. By presenting conflicting testimonies, flawed investigators, and evolving evidence, these movies encourage viewers to evaluate credibility, question assumptions, and consider multiple perspectives. This mental exercise mirrors real-life decision-making, even if the stakes are fictional.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One common myth is that these films are simply "true crime adaptations." In reality, most are works of fiction that use legal settings as a backdrop for exploring human behavior. Another misunderstanding is that they promote cynicism about the justice system. While some do critique institutional flaws, many also highlight perseverance, integrity, and the possibility of redemption within complex frameworks. Recognizing this spectrum prevents oversimplified judgments and encourages a more nuanced appreciation of the genre.
